The clip ending scene from Wordplay (2006)
A day without the puzzle?
Well, it's not like insulin. I mean, I can live without it for a day.
Crossword puzzles are something that feed into a basic human need...
to figure things out.
It allows you to be open-minded and lets you think about...
other parts of the language that maybe you weren't necessarily thinkin' about.
The regularity of it the fact that it's always there for you
is very, very appealing.
I think it's much more about the words than it is about the music...
but, you know, words they connect us.
Language is it. This is the
the most powerful force, I believe, on Earth is the English language.
The ability to communicate clearly and forcefully
I think it's profoundly important.
I think that, um I don't know. They're fun.
I hope whoever succeeds me at the Times is someone who carries on the tradition...
of having crosswords that speak people's language...
and somebody who will use puzzles that are just jam-packed...
with interesting, lively, juicy, fun vocabulary...
and continues to innovate.
And at Stamford, I hope, when I'm 95, that someone will wheel me in in a wheelchair...
and I'll have drool coming down the side of my mouth...
and, um, I just hope the event is still goin' on and people are having a great time.
